Nate Oats appears to call out Mark Sears after benching guard in second half

Nate Oats appears to call out Mark Sears after benching guard in second half

Alabama extended its winning streak to three on Saturday, holding off LSU in Tuscaloosa. They did so without Mark Sears as the star guard did not play the entire second half. The absence was not injury-related, at least according to the SEC Network broadcast.

Nate Oats was asked about Sears spending the second half on the bench but did not directly speak on the situation. Instead, he decided to emphasize how much better Alabama played on the defensive end. Poor efforts in the first half caused for a tight game and Oats decided to roll with a group he thought was capable of earning a win.

“This is all I’m gonna say about playing time stuff,” Oats said postgame. “We played the guys in the second half that we thought gave us the best chance to win the game, and we on the game. Our defense was significantly better in the second half than in the first half, and we haven’t done that much this year.”
